-> MFA for local accounts is enforced by default starting with the Yokohama release
-> for older instances or if a custom MFA policy was already in place before the upgrade, MFA may not be enforced automatically. In such cases, you need to manually enable and configure the default MFA policy to ensure enforcement for local accounts
